In 2023, Google has released its ‘Year in Search’ list, categorizing the top keywords searched on the internet throughout the year. The list covers various categories such as news, entertainment, memes, travel, recipes, and more.

The most searched event was the launch of Chandrayaan-3, marking India as the fourth country to land on the moon, specifically the South Pole. Other notable searches include the Karnataka Election Results, Israel News, Satish Kaushik, Budget 2023, Turkey Earthquake, Atiq Ahmed, Matthew Perry, Manipur News, and the Odisha Train Accident.

The conflict between Israel and Hamas, initiated by a surprise attack by Hamas operatives on October 7, caught the interest of users. The deaths of actor and director Satish Kaushik and ‘Friends’ star Matthew Perry are also featured on the list.

Google categorized the ‘Year in Search 2023’ results, including questions asked while searching for news or events on the internet. Queries about G20, UCC (Uniform Civil Code), ChatGPT, Hamas, events on September 28, 2023, Chandrayaan 3, Threads in Instagram, timeouts in cricket, impact players in IPL, and Sengol are part of the list.

The ‘How To’ list encompasses queries ranging from preventing sun damage to skin and hair with home remedies, reaching the first 5k followers on YouTube, getting good at kabaddi, improving car mileage, becoming a chess grandmaster, surprising a sister on Rakshabandhan, identifying a pure Kanjivaram silk saree, checking PAN link with Aadhar, creating a WhatsApp channel, and getting a blue tick on Instagram.

In the sports category, cricket dominates the top searches, with queries related to the Indian Premier League, Cricket World Cup, Asia Cup, Women’s Premier League, Asian Games, Indian Super League, Pakistan Super League, The Ashes, Women’s Cricket World Cup, and SA20.
